Output 695ffd82333fe5f6436a81cd89fd65882ee4a0b29ce6157a9a2eee8cd662d783:84

value
43104988
script pubkey
OP_0 OP_PUSHBYTES_20 3e195707a7535b404a4159be59177bcd6f991ae8
address
bc1q8cv4wpa82dd5qjjptxl9j9mme4hejxhg83l5un
transaction
695ffd82333fe5f6436a81cd89fd65882ee4a0b29ce6157a9a2eee8cd662d783